Description

Robert B. Reich explores the idea that a common good is at the heart of any society, and that it can be strengthened through virtuous cycles, but undermined by vicious ones. He argues that America has been experiencing a cycle of decline for five decades and that this process can be reversed. Reich examines the moral obligations of citizenship and considers how we relate to concepts such as honor, shame, patriotism, truth, and leadership. His work is a call to action, urging us to re-examine our values and relationships in order to build a more just society. This book offers a powerful and urgent vision for creating a better future, one that prioritizes the common good above individual interests.
